[Sri Lanka] - New DGs designated to Coast Conservation Dept. and Central Cultural Fund

INSUBCONTINENT EXCLUSIVE:
The Cabinet of Ministers has actually given approval to select Rear Admiral Y.R
Serasinghe as the new Director General of the Sri Lanka Coast Conservation Department.Rear Admiral Pujitha Vithana, who had served as the
Director General of Sri Lanka Coast Conservation Department, retired from the service on September 13, 2024 after the completion of 55 years
of service.Accordingly, the Cabinet of Ministers has authorized the proposition presented by the President, in his capacity as the Minister
of Defense, to select Rear Admiral Y.R
Serasinghe to the said post of Director General of the Sri Lanka Coast Conservation Department.Serasinghe is serving as a Deputy Director
General of the Department of Coast Conservation at present.Meanwhile, the Cabinet of Ministers has actually likewise given approval to
designate Dr
T.M.J
Nilan Cooray to the post of Director General of the Central Cultural Fund (CCF) on a contract basis.Since Prof
Gamini Ranasinghe, who acted as the Director General of the Central Cultural Fund, has resigned from the post, the stated post is presently
vacant.It has been acknowledged that Dr
T.M.J
Nilan Cooray, who has training and experience in the field of regional and foreign archeology, architecture and archeology conservation, and
has provided management and assistance to lots of publication projects and academic research, appropriates for the said post, the Cabinet
Spokesman said.Accordingly, the Cabinet of Ministers has actually approved the proposition provided by the Minister of Buddhism, Religious
and Cultural Affairs, National Integration, Social Security, and Mass Media to appoint Dr
T.M.J
Nilan Cooray to the post of Director General of the CCF on an agreement basis.
